• The glucocorticoid receptor (GR or GCR) also known as NR3C1 (nuclear receptor subfamily 3, group C, member 1) is the receptor to which cortisol and other glucocorticoids bind. (wikipedia.org)
  • After the receptor is bound to glucocorticoid, the receptor-glucocorticoid complex can take either of two paths. (wikipedia.org)
  • The endogenous glucocorticoid hormone cortisol diffuses through the cell membrane into the cytoplasm and binds to the glucocorticoid receptor (GR) resulting in release of the heat shock proteins. (wikipedia.org)
  • In central nervous system structures, the glucocorticoid receptor is gaining interest as a novel representative of neuroendocrine integration, functioning as a major component of endocrine influence - specifically the stress response - upon the brain. (wikipedia.org)
  • Dexamethasone and other corticosteroids are agonists, while mifepristone and ketoconazole are antagonists of the GR. Anabolic steroids also prevent cortisol from binding to the glucocorticoid receptor. (wikipedia.org)

  • At the cellular level, the actions of glucocorticoids are mediated by a 94-kd protein, the glucocorticoid receptor (GR). The human (h) GR belongs to the steroid/thyroid/retinoic acid superfamily of nuclear receptors and functions as a ligand-dependent transcription factor that regulates the expression of glucocorticoid-responsive genes positively or negatively.   • NEW YORK (Reuters Health) - Long-term glucocorticoid treatment is associated with slower progression and reduced risk of death in patients with Duchenne muscular dystrophy, according to results from the Cooperative International Neuromuscular Research Group (CINRG). (medscape.com)
  • Previous studies have provided moderate-quality evidence that glucocorticoid therapy improves muscle strength or function or both for up to 2 years in patients with Duchenne muscular dystrophy, but there are also clinically significant adverse effects of long-term glucocorticoid treatment. (medscape.com)
  • There were 28 deaths (9%) in 311 patients treated with glucocorticoids for 1 year or longer, compared with 11 deaths (19%) in 58 patients with no history of glucocorticoid use (P=0.0501). (medscape.com)
  • The risk of death increased 4.10-fold after patients reached a forced vital capacity (FVC) of 1 liter or less, but better survival in those taking glucocorticoids compared with nonusers did not appear to be attributable to greater use of noninvasive mechanical ventilation. (medscape.com)

  • The DNA-binding domain (DBD) of the hGRα corresponds to amino acids 420-480 and contains 2 zinc finger motifs through which the hGRα binds to specific DNA sequences, the glucocorticoid-response elements (GREs) in the promoter region(s) of target genes. (medscape.com)
